Practical tips to maximize deals and avoid traps

  • Time your purchase around holidays and end-of-quarter promotions, but beware fake countdowns and "one-time only" flash sales.

  • Look for bundles that include filament, nozzle kits, and a basic enclosure, because these extras lower your total cost of ownership.

  • Verify compatibility: ensure the printer works with your preferred slicer and filament brands.

  • Check the warranty and return policy, and understand what is covered if the print head clogs or the bed tilts.

  • Read reviews from peers who run comparable projects; don’t just rely on marketing pages.

  • Consider a refurbished unit with a warranty if you’re comfortable with cosmetic scuffs but want a higher-value option.

This practical approach helps you identify genuine savings while avoiding common pitfalls.

How to calibrate and maximize prints on sale printers

Calibrating a printer bought on sale remains essential to getting good results. Start with bed leveling and nozzle height using a standard probe or a piece of A4 paper. Calibrate extrusion multiplier, temperature, and print speed for your chosen material. Use calipers or test cubes to verify dimensions and adjust flow. After initial prints, keep nozzle clean and inspect the cooling fans and belt tension.

With any printer, routine maintenance reduces downtime. Replace worn parts, keep firmware up to date, and keep a stock of common consumables like nozzles and heat breaks. Finally, store your printer away from humidity and dust; a clean workstation pays dividends in print quality and consistency.

Is an enclosure important for ABS printing?

Yes. An enclosure stabilizes temperature, reduces drafts, and improves safety when printing ABS or other high-temperature materials. It also helps reduce noise in shared spaces.

What filament types are supported by most budget printers?

PLA is widely supported on budget machines; PETG and flexible filaments vary by model. If you expect diverse materials, pick a mid-range or enclosed model with broader material support.
